Changed defaults in Splitfork, our assignment service. Bucketing now uses sticky hashing per account instead of per session, and the holdout slice grew from 2% to 5%. Callers relying on session-level reassignment must opt in explicitly. Review the diff against the new baseline; the updated default configuration is listed below.

config for tagep-kajof:
[casir]
port = 6379
region = south-1
host = casir.paliqdyn.example
team = tamax
timeout_ms = 250
retries = 2

[ ] Cold storage archival — Glacierette buckets (Key Ceremony, Q3)

Owner: Pallas team. Before archiving the frozen buckets, rotate the sealing key and verify the two witness signatures in the ceremony log. Archival cannot proceed until the vault is unsealed once more for the final export, using the passphrase below.

unlock words, yawig-kagef: gordor-holvan-ulaael-pramir-ulaiel-tamdor

- [ ] **Step 7: Breaker override escrow.** After sealing the signing keys for the Tallgrove upstream API circuit breaker, confirm the support team can force the breaker open during a full outage. The override bundle lives in the sealed escrow drawer and is useless without its unlock phrase. Two ceremony witnesses must initial this step before proceeding. The escrow bundle is decrypted with the recovery passphrase that follows.

vault phrase of kahip-kahop = holath-quenmir